Formed in 2005, Speedworks Motorsport entered the BTCC in 2011, becoming one of the first teams to field an NGTC-spec car with a Toyota Avensis for Tony Hughes. The Cheshire-based operation branched out in 2012 by adding a second car for championship debutant Adam Morgan, whilst stand-in Paul O’Neill was a stand-out at Knockhill with a trio of top six finishes highlighted by fourth position in race two – the team’s best result to-date.

That helped the squad to tenth in the final teams’ standings that year and sixth in the Independents’ title chase. Following Hughes’ retirement and Morgan’s departure, Dave Newsham and Ollie Jackson took over the driving duties in 2013, with the former proving to be a regular points-scorer and annexing a top ten championship position as Speedworks improved to seventh in the teams’ table and fifth-best Independent. For 2014, the outfit has slimmed down to a single-car entry for promising three-time Ginetta champion Tom Ingram.

Speedworks Motorsport is a British motor racing team based in Sandbach, Cheshire. The team was formed in 2005 by Christian and Amy Dick. They are best known for competing in the British Touring Car Championship since 2011. They also compete in the British GT Championship.
